Jared POV

After that, the party was pretty much over for me. I quickly left, not saying goodbye to anyone and went back to my house. I wasn't in the mood right now to be dealing with drunken idiots and girls who are throwing themselves, and their underwear, at me.

I didn't sleep a wink that night, everything just kept replaying in my head.

Leah was dead. And the bitch was haunting me.

I don't understand why I am the only one who can see her. I don't even know how she died, I thought she had just done a Leah and disappeared for a few days.

I kept ignoring this feeling in my stomach. It kept popping up when I thought of Leah being dead, which was basically non-stop. Did I miss her? How could I considering she wasn't actually gone. I think it was just the fact that she was dead, I mean I may hate her but I can't lie and say that I don't enjoy spending time with her, I mean who doesn't enjoy pissing other people off?

Yeah cos that's the reason why you enjoy spending time with her.

 

 

 

 

 

I ignored this little voice in my head, the stupid pain in the ass.

After my sleepless night, I got changed and made my way to school. The entire day went by in a daze, I vaguely remember people talking to me and me giving them sort of response, like a shrug or a grunt. It was only at lunch that I started to pay attention.

"You really are a jerk Jared!" Eve hissed, sitting down on the table I was on in the cafeteria.

I looked up, not really bothered by the comment.

"Wow, you tell me that as if I've never heard it before" I replied. "I'm hurt Clear, I may have to go home and cry soft tears"

She glared at me. "Thanks to you I'm lacking my best friend for the next few days!"

This caught my attention. Do I tell her about Leah being dead?

Of course not idiot, what are you going to say, your best friends dead and I know this because I saw her ghost last night?

 

 

Fair point annoying voice.

"It's not my fault." I mumbled. She kept whining, and rested her head on Max's shoulder.

It was me, Eve, Max, Seth and Tyler sat on the table.

"Baby, I'm bored, trip to the janitors closet?" Carmen purred in my ear, and started rubbing my arm. Oh yeah, she was sat here too.

 

 

 

 

 

Carmen was my latest thing. She thought we were dating, I got pretty adequate sex. It was a good arrangement.

"Baby?" it would be an even better arrangement if her voice didn't make me want to slap her every time she spoke.

"How do you know Leah took off?" I asked Eve, ignoring Carmen. She sighed and took her hand off my arm, slumping back down on her seat.

"She text me Monday night" Eve responded, taking her head off Max's shoulder, much to his disappointment. I swear them two are screwing...

 

 

 

 

 

"and me" Seth piped up, taking a bite out of his burger. I liked the guy and all, but sometimes I had a sudden urge to rip his pale little head off. Why, I don't know.

Leah couldn't have text them Monday night, I didn't know for definite, but I'm assuming that's the night she died. I don't think she would have really had time to stop to text?

"What did the text say exactly?" I asked them both.

Eve got her phone out of her pocket, looking slightly confused as to why I was asking so many questions about this. She pressed a few buttons, and then started reading the text.

"'Hey, taking off for a few days, need time to myself, that argument really got to me earlier. I'll text you in a few days to see when I'm coming back. Love you xoxo'" she read the text off her phone from Leah, making me wince a little when she mentioned the argument.

"I got the same text, apart from mine said Love you babe" Seth smiled sheepishly.

How was that input at all helpful? Again, I had that urge for the head ripping thing.

 

 

 

 

 

"What the hell happened between you two Monday?" Max asked, looking slightly amused.

"Nothing we just had an argument" I replied, a little too quickly. I swiftly recovered with something that I was more likely to say "It's not my fault that girl is so freaking sensitive is it?"

Much better, its definitely more you. Asshole-ish.

 

 

 

 

 

I had a sudden urge to grab the fork on the table and stab myself in the head, just so I could shut this damn voice up.

"Well you must have said something really bad for her to take off, she hasn't done that in so long" Eve scowled at me. I knew she didn't like me, I think it was because Leah hated me and she felt the need to support her best friend. Women and their loyalties.

 

 

 

 

 

"Nothing different to usual" I mumbled. She just rolled her eyes.

The only reason we hung out is because of Max. They've been this weird couple thing for as long as I remember. They weren't officially dating, I think they were still screwing, and whenever either of them went out with anyone else they would bicker because they were jealous.

I remember one time a few months ago Max was seeing this other girl, Eve didn't like it, so her and Leah invited her round for a 'girly night' which ended with the poor girl coming into school the next day with half of her hair shaved off. I've gotta admit, it was pretty funny.

That's why so many people were scared of them; Leah and Eve were the two girls in this school who you just don't fuck with. They were both crazy, and that teamed up with the scheming little minds it did not add up well for any other girl, or guy for that matter, in this school who got on their bad side.

Max wasn't much better though to be fair, the last guy Eve dated ended up with a broken nose.

So all in all, those two were pretty suited.

"Anyway, I rang Leah's mum the same night to make sure she knew, you know what Leah's like, and she said she got the same text. She was pretty fine with it, as usual"

Both me and Eve scoffed. One thing we did agree on, when it came to parenting, Leah's mum was about as adequate as a dead dog. It always amazed me that every time Leah pulled one of her disappearing acts, she was never bothered about it. We've lived on the same street for 10 years, so I've seen her go off many of times, and each time my parents would go over to make sure that her mum was coping okay, and each time they were amazed by how phased she actually wasn't.

"Right I'm bored talking about her" Carmen moaned next to me, saying the word her with as much venom as she could spit out. I don't know why, but she seemed to think that me and Leah had a 'thing' therefore they were never really the best of friends.

Fair enough we did, but the only 'thing' me and Leah shared now was a mutual hatred.

The next thing I knew, I heard Carmen scream and the lightshade above her head shattered, sending broken class sprinkling over our heads. I quickly lunged out of my seat; pulling Carmen out of the way as the lightshade came crashing down directly where she was sitting.

I may not actually like the girl, but I'm not going to let her die am I?

We both tumbled onto the floor, as the remaining glass from the lightshade smashed onto the seat. This automatically sent everything into chaos, and I heard a few screams around the cafeteria.

 I looked at our table, which was now empty as Max pulled Eve out of the way, and Seth and Tyler also moved pretty snappishly.

"What the hell just happened? Who ever put those bloody things on the ceiling clearly is lacking skill in the job they are doing!" Eve screamed. "Are you okay?"

I noticed she actually asked me, not Carmen. She wasn't particularly fond of Carmen either to be honest. I nodded my head and got to my feet, as did Carmen who was still letting out small screams and repeating the words 'oh my god' over and over. Eve sighed.

"Should have let the damn thing crush her..." Eve muttered under her breath. I had to stop myself from laughing.

"Oh baby, you saved my life!" Carmen cried and wrapped her arms around my neck, making me feel like I was being choked.

Maybe I should have let that thing crush the annoying bitch.

--

I was now home, it had just gone 4 and I was later home than usual considering our entire table had to be taken to the medical room to make sure we were okay. I had to stop myself from backhanding Carmen who was clinging on to my arm like leech, now I saved her life I'm thinking she might be in love with me or something?

Oh Christ, what have I done?

I was sat on my bed, with my back against the wall thinking about what happened in the cafeteria. My room wasn't big, but it had my bed in the corner, a desk with a TV and CD player/radio on it, a wardrobe and a sofa. It was a little cramped, but it would do. I only used this room for sleeping and robbing girls of their dignity.

"Your room is an actual shit heap" I literally must have jumped out of my skin as I heard that voice. I looked over at the sofa and saw Leah sat down, with her legs crossed looking around my room with a disgusted look in her eyes. It only clicked a few seconds later, but when she made me jump I let out a scream. Well, more of a shriek to be honest. Leah's face turned into one of pure amusement.

"Very butch" she said, trying to hide her grin.
